TORRANCE, Calif. — For more than eight years, SCHOOL BUS FLEET has put the spotlight on outstanding pupil transportation operations with the “Great Fleets Across America” series.
The series will return in our upcoming January issue, but with a twist: This time around, we’ll give added focus to school districts’ and contractors’ green efforts. We’re calling it, appropriately enough, “Green Fleets Across America.”
The criteria that have applied to Great Fleets in the past still apply — excellence in such areas as safety, training, innovation, cost cutting, maintenance and morale. But for this year's edition, we’ll also be looking for environmental efforts. These may include:
use of emissions-reducing equipment (diesel particulate filters, etc.)
use of alternative fuels
anti-idling policies
increasing route efficiency
recycling and waste reduction
environmental community service (tree planting, trash collecting, etc.)
use of energy-saving devices and sustainable materials in facilities
